One arrested with illegal gold from Gautam Buddha International Airport



BHAIRAHAWA: Police arrested a passenger with gold jewelry from Gautam Buddha International Airport (GBIA) in Bhairahawa on Saturday.

Rajendra Kunwar of Palpa Ribdikat, who arrived at Gautam Buddha International Airport via Jajira Airways, was arrested along with gold jewelry.

According to Tirtha Raj Paswan, the Customs Officer at GBIA, Kunwar was arrested with 122 grams of gold jewelry hidden in socks.

Kunwar had come from Qatar to Kathmandu via Jajira Airways was hiding three chains and a bracelet jewelry. The estimated value of the jewelry is Rs 990,000, according to the airport customs.

The police are investigating further for details.
